Output 643fae6c7936753920fe51280d3fbd0be11973647613bade81b673d2010f2e20:9

value
17914193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a4396001ae02faafdf718e2037b874f66efa3d OP_EQUAL
address
MUqPhrL9999o1hYDEK7R9so4773Ab8ASAg
transaction
643fae6c7936753920fe51280d3fbd0be11973647613bade81b673d2010f2e20
spent
true